Stvaranje iPhone aplikacije izvrstan je način da svoju kreativnost podijelite sa svijetom. U ovom članku, pokazat ćemo vam kako napraviti iPhone aplikaciju na jednostavan i pristupačan način, bez potrebe da budete stručnjak za programiranje. Od početne ideje do objave na App Storeu, vodit ćemo vas kroz svaki korak procesa, tako da možete vidjeti kako vaša aplikacija oživljava u digitalnom svijetu. Ako ste spremni pretvoriti svoje ideje u stvarnost, čitajte dalje i otkrijte sve što trebate znati za razvoj svoje prve iPhone aplikacije!
– Korak po korak ➡️ Kako napraviti aplikaciju za iPhone
- Istražite i isplanirajte svoju ideju – Prije nego što počnete razvijati svoju aplikaciju, važno je jasno razumjeti što želite postići. Saznajte postoji li vaša ideja već u App Storeu i koje značajke biste mogli dodati kako biste je učinili jedinstvenom.
- Prijavite se kao Apple Developer – Kako biste svoju aplikaciju objavili u App Storeu, morat ćete se registrirati kao Apple programer. Kako napraviti iPhone aplikaciju
- Koristite Xcode za razvoj svoje aplikacije – Xcode je Appleovo integrirano razvojno okruženje (IDE), koje vam omogućuje stvaranje aplikacija za iPhone. Naučite kako koristiti ovaj alat za programiranje i dizajn vaše aplikacije.
- Naučite programski jezik Swift - Swift je Appleov preferirani programski jezik za razvoj iOS aplikacija. Upoznajte se s ovim jezikom i vježbajte pisanje koda.
- Dizajnirajte korisničko sučelje – Korisničko sučelje ključno je za uspjeh vaše aplikacije. Provedite vrijeme osmišljavajući intuitivno i privlačno korisničko iskustvo za svoje korisnike.
- Testirajte i otklonite pogreške svoje aplikacije - Prije nego što objavite svoju aplikaciju, obavezno obavite opsežno testiranje i popravite sve pogreške ili probleme koje pronađete.
- Registrirajte svoju aplikaciju u App Storeu – Nakon što je vaša aplikacija spremna za objavljivanje, prijavite se za Apple Developer Program i slijedite korake za slanje aplikacije na pregled i objavljivanje u App Storeu.
- Promovirajte svoju aplikaciju – Nakon što se vaša aplikacija nađe u App Storeu, počnite je promovirati putem društvenih medija, blogova i drugih platformi kako biste povećali njezinu vidljivost i dobili više preuzimanja.
Pitanja i odgovori
1. Koji su zahtjevi za izradu iPhone aplikacije?
- Prijavite se kao programer u Apple Developer Program.
- Preuzmite Xcode, Appleovo integrirano razvojno okruženje.
- Nabavite iOS uređaj da testirate svoju aplikaciju.
- Upoznajte se s programskim jezicima Swift ili Objective-C.
2. Kako mogu naučiti programirati iPhone aplikacije?
- Pohađajte tečaj programiranja za iOS online ili osobno.
- Pogledajte službenu Apple dokumentaciju za programere.
- Vježbajte s tutorialima i projektima otvorenog koda.
- Sudjelujte u zajednicama programera za razmjenu znanja i iskustava.
3. Koji su mi alati potrebni za izradu iPhone aplikacije?
- Xcode, Appleovo integrirano razvojno okruženje.
- iOS uređaj za testiranje i otklanjanje pogrešaka u aplikaciji.
- Uređivač teksta ili IDE kompatibilan sa Swiftom ili Objective-C.
- Grafički i dizajnerski resursi za korisničko sučelje.
4. Koliko košta izrada iPhone aplikacije?
- Cijena Apple Developer Programa je $99 USD godišnje.
- Potrošnja na razvoj hardvera i softvera ovisi o vašim potrebama.
- Trošak angažiranja programera ili razvojnog tima ako to ne možete učiniti sami.
- Proračun za marketing, oglašavanje i promociju aplikacije.
5. Kako mogu objaviti svoju aplikaciju na App Storeu?
- Pripremite svoju aplikaciju s potrebnim podacima, kao što su naslov, opis i snimke zaslona.
- Stvorite ID aplikacije u programu Apple Developer i postavite svoju aplikaciju u aplikaciji iTunes Connect.
- Pošaljite svoju aplikaciju na pregled i pričekajte odobrenje od Applea.
- Nakon odobrenja postavite cijenu, dostupnost i datum izdavanja svoje aplikacije.
6. Koje su najbolje prakse za dizajniranje iPhone aplikacije?
- Zadržite čist i minimalistički dizajn za ugodno korisničko iskustvo.
- Koristi izvorne elemente iOS korisničkog sučelja za besprijekornu integraciju s operativnim sustavom.
- Optimizira sučelje za zaslone različitih veličina i razlučivosti.
- Provedite testove upotrebljivosti i prikupite povratne informacije korisnika kako biste poboljšali dizajn aplikacije.
7. Kako mogu unovčiti svoju iPhone aplikaciju?
- Ponudite aplikaciju kao preuzimanje koje se plaća na App Storeu.
- Implementirajte kupnje unutar aplikacije za otključavanje dodatnog sadržaja ili značajki.
- Integrirajte oglase u aplikaciju putem mobilnih mreža za oglašavanje.
- Razmotrite model pretplate ili freemium, gdje je aplikacija besplatna, ali nudi izbornu kupnju.
8. Kako mogu promovirati svoju iPhone aplikaciju?
- Izradite web mjesto ili odredišnu stranicu za svoju aplikaciju s informacijama i vezama za preuzimanje.
- Koristite društvene mreže za dijeljenje vijesti, ažuriranja i promocije aplikacije.
- Surađujte s blogerima,influencerima ili medijskim kućama za recenzije i izvještavanje o aplikaciji.
- Razmislite o plaćenom oglašavanju na platformama kao što su Google Ads ili Facebook Ads kako biste dosegli više korisnika.
9. Kako mogu poboljšati rad svoje iPhone aplikacije?
- Optimizira kod aplikacije kako bi se smanjilo opterećenje i poboljšala brzina odgovora.
- Implementira učinkovito korištenje memorije i odgovarajuće upravlja resursima uređaja.
- Provedite testove performansi i popravite potencijalna uska grla ili probleme s skalabilnošću.
- Redovito ažurirajte aplikaciju kako bi bila kompatibilna s najnovijim verzijama iOS-a i uređajima.
10. Što trebam učiniti nakon pokretanja aplikacije za iPhone?
- Pratite mjerne podatke i izvedbu aplikacije, kao što su preuzimanja, prihod i komentari korisnika.
- Pruža korisničku podršku i odgovara na korisnička pitanja, probleme ili prijedloge.
- Redovito ažurirajte aplikaciju s poboljšanjima, ispravcima pogrešaka i novim značajkama.
- Razmislite o širenju na druga tržišta ili platforme ako je aplikacija uspješna i postoji potražnja.
Ja sam Sebastián Vidal, računalni inženjer strastven za tehnologiju i DIY. Nadalje, ja sam kreator tecnobits.com, gdje dijelim vodiče kako bih tehnologiju učinio pristupačnijom i razumljivijom svima.